WebA pile of soaking wet clothing is much heavier than a pile of wrung out clothes. When you place a heavy load in the dryer, it will put a strain on its bearings. The heavy load will, as you already know, not come out evenly dry, and it can damage your dryer too. … WebWhat happens if you dry soaking wet clothes? Just be sure to check your dark clothes for any color bleeding before you put them in with your whites. WebLay a towel on the bed and drape the item on the towel. Roll up the clothes and towel together, then wring them. This transfers a lot of the moisture to the towel. Let it hang dry overnight somewhere with as much airflow as possible. If you have an iron you can speed the process further by ironing the item before hanging it up.

WebMar 26, 2013 · The idea is that by adding a dry and absorbent material, some of the moisture from the wet fabrics is wicked away by the dry towel. This reduces the moisture inside the dryer, allowing each item to dry out more quickly.
